BACKGROUND

The Agriculture and Food Authority (AFA) is a State Corporation established under section 3 of the AFA Act No.13 of 2013. The mandate of AFA is to regulate the crops sector in Kenya, to ensure compliance with the regulatory framework, standards, and codes of practice. As a regulator, it fosters a thriving competitive environment where innovation, technological progress, order and quality flourish, for sustainable economic growth. The AFA Act provides for consolidation of the Laws on the regulation and promotion of Agriculture generally and makes provision for the respective roles of National and County Government in Agriculture and related matters in furtherance of the relevant provision of the fourth schedule of the constitution.

STATISTICS OFFICER II, GRADE AFA 8 (10 VACANCIES)

Job Responsibilities

Duties and responsibilities at this grade will entail:

(i) Collecting data on scheduled crops;
(ii) Collating data on scheduled crops for analysis;
(iii) Monitoring the status and trends of all scheduled crops value chains;
(iv) Conducting regular market research and surveys; and
(v) Archiving and retrieving statistical data as required.

Person Specifications

For appointment to this grade, an officer must have:

(i) Bachelor's degree in any of the following disciplines: Statistics, Mathematics, Economics, Computer Science, Actuarial Science, Agricultural Sciences, Agricultural Engineering, Agricultural Economics, Agribusiness Management, Commerce or equivalent qualification from a recognized institution; and
(ii) Proficiency in computer applications.

ADDITIONAL INFORMATION

Shortlisted candidates will be required to satisfy the requirements of Chapter Six of the Constitution of Kenya 2010 by providing; Police Clearance Certificate from the Directorate of Criminal Investigations; Clearance Certificate from the Higher Education Loans Board; Tax Compliance Certificate from the Kenya Revenue Authority; Clearance from the Ethics and Anti-Corruption Commission; Report from an Approved Credit Reference Bureau; and clearance from Commission for University Education for degrees obtained outside Kenya.
